A Title 1 tutor works with students who qualify for Title 1, which is a program designed to help low-income students succeed. As a Title 1 tutor, your responsibility is to provide supplemental educational opportunities for your students. Title 1 allocates resources specifically for math, reading, writing, and other language arts education. Tutors should be specialists in one of these areas. Your job duties in this career are assessing the student’s needs, designing an appropriate program, and helping the student with their school work. Tutors may work as part of a private company that contracts with the county or school district.
